Finding GCD of 109, 942, 201, 850 using Prime Factorization

Given Input Data is 109, 942, 201, 850

Make a list of Prime Factors of all the given numbers initially

Prime Factorization of 109 is 109

Prime Factorization of 942 is 2 x 3 x 157

Prime Factorization of 201 is 3 x 67

Prime Factorization of 850 is 2 x 5 x 5 x 17

The above numbers do not have any common prime factor. So GCD is 1
